Setting clear goals is essential because it gives you a sense of direction and purpose. Without a roadmap, it’s like wandering aimlessly without a destination in mind. It’s crucial to take the time to identify what you truly want to achieve and create a plan to get there.

When setting goals, it’s important to make them specific, measurable, attainable, relevant, and time-bound – known as SMART goals. For example, instead of saying, “I want to improve my fitness,” a SMART goal would be, “I will run a 5K race within six months by following a training program and maintaining a healthy diet.”

By setting specific goals, you give yourself something tangible to work towards. It’s not just wishful thinking; it becomes a concrete target that you can break down into smaller, actionable steps. This way, you can track your progress and make adjustments along the way.

Self-discipline is like a muscle that needs to be exercised and strengthened. It involves making conscious choices and taking consistent actions that align with our goals and values. By practicing self-discipline, we develop the ability to stay focused, resist temptations, and persevere through challenges.

A growth mindset, on the other hand, is the belief that our abilities can be developed through dedication and hard work. It is the understanding that intelligence and talent are not fixed traits but can be cultivated and improved over time. With a growth mindset, we embrace challenges as opportunities for growth and see failure as a stepping stone toward success.

Physical fitness plays a crucial role in personal growth. Regular exercise not only improves our physical health but also has a significant impact on our mental well-being. It’s no secret that exercise releases endorphins, those feel-good chemicals that boost our mood and reduce stress. By incorporating exercise into our daily routine, we can increase our energy levels, enhance our concentration, and improve our overall performance in all aspects of life.

It’s important to remember that physical fitness doesn’t necessarily mean spending hours at the gym or running marathons. It’s about finding an activity that you genuinely enjoy and making it a regular part of your life. Whether it’s dancing, yoga, swimming, or going for a walk in nature, the key is to find something that brings you joy and keeps you active.

In addition to physical fitness, self-care is another essential component of habit 3. Taking care of ourselves goes beyond just pampering and relaxation; it’s about prioritizing our well-being and nurturing our mind, body, and soul.

Self-care can take many forms, depending on what resonates with you. It might involve practicing mindfulness and meditation to quiet the mind and reduce stress. It could also mean carving out time for hobbies and activities that bring you joy and help you unwind. Engaging in activities that promote creativity, such as painting, writing, or playing a musical instrument, can be incredibly therapeutic and provide a much-needed outlet for self-expression.

Another crucial aspect of self-care is ensuring we get adequate rest and sleep. In today’s fast-paced world, it’s easy to overlook the importance of rest, but it’s essential for our overall well-being. Making sleep a priority allows our bodies to recharge, repair, and rejuvenate, enhancing our productivity and mental clarity.
